libgsf needs revbump following libffi upgrade

Description

dyld: Library not loaded: /opt/local/lib/libffi.5.dylib
  Referenced from: /opt/local/lib/libgsf-1.114.dylib
  Reason: image not found
Trace/BPT trap

libffi.6.dylib appears to be the current version

A revbump for libgsf already occurred in r93892 so the port should already have been rebuilt against the new libffi. However we did not at that time add a dependency on libffi so perhaps it got rebuilt before libffi got rebuilt. I added the dependency in r95322 and again increased the revision which should once and for all fix this. Please ensure your port definitions are up to date (sudo port selfupdate) and all your ports are upgraded to the latest versions (sudo port upgrade outdated).
